Every real estate agent in Brazil knows the routine: shoot with your phone, spend two hours editing, pay R$500 for a photographer who books out a week — and still end up with a listing that looks like everyone else's.

BrokerLens.ai processes uploaded property photos through automatic HDR correction, room classification, and duplicate detection, then exports watermarked images and cinematic slideshow or drone-effect videos formatted for Instagram Reels and YouTube — the vendor states roughly 3 seconds per photo and 60 seconds to generate a video. The virtual furniture feature (marked BETA) applies one of four Brazilian-market style presets to empty rooms and detects open-concept layouts, so a bare sala+cozinha combo gets furnished without bleeding zones together. Batch ZIP export with your agency logo watermarked in one pass removes the per-photo manual step that kills volume agencies. The ceiling appears when you need editorial-grade retouching or architectural correction beyond what the one-click generative edit can express — at that point you are opening Lightroom anyway.

Bottom line: This earns its place in a high-volume Brazilian agency's stack for standardizing phone-shot listings at scale — but teams that need precise object removal, complex color grading, or API-driven integration into an existing CRM will hit a wall with no programmatic exit.

  • Automatic HDR correction per room type without manual sliders, so a phone-shot kitchen and a basement bathroom each receive context-appropriate lighting treatment rather than a flat one-size filter that makes half the gallery look worse.
  • Perceptual hash duplicate detection reviews near-identical frames in bulk, so an agent who shot 40 photos with 12 accidental duplicates does not spend 20 minutes comparing thumbnails before uploading to the listing portal.
  • Drone-effect video generation from still images produces moving-camera social content without hiring a drone operator or video editor, which means a solo agent can match the production look of a full-service agency for a single listing.
  • Single-upload logo watermarking applied across an entire batch enforces brand consistency across an agency with dozens of agents, avoiding the version-control problem where half the listings go out unbranded.
  • Virtual furniture with Brazilian-market presets that respect open-concept zone separation means an empty apartamento padrão can be staged for a listing without a physical staging team or a designer interpreting foreign-market aesthetics.
  • Generative editing is limited to one-click actions (remove object, clean clutter, add décor) plus a text instruction field — teams needing precise architectural correction like straightening converging verticals, removing a structural beam, or replacing a blown-out window view will find the toolset too blunt and open Lightroom or Photoshop for those shots, running two editing workflows in parallel.
  • No API and no self-hosted option means every photo enters the platform through a browser upload; agencies that have already built a CRM or property management system and want processing triggered automatically on new listing creation cannot wire BrokerLens.ai into that flow — teams that hit this wall at scale switch to a general-purpose image processing API and rebuild the room-classification and video logic themselves or drop those features entirely.
  • Virtual furniture is in BETA and delivers four preset style categories; agencies working luxury or niche segments where the client's brief specifies a specific aesthetic will get a result that needs manual art direction or reshooting, negating the time saving the feature is built to deliver.

BrokerLens.ai is a cloud-based photo and video processing platform built specifically for Brazilian real estate agents and agencies. The core workflow is upload-and-export: drop in property photos, the platform applies automatic HDR lighting correction per room type, classifies each shot by environment (sala, quarto, banheiro, fachada, integrados), flags near-duplicate frames via perceptual hash comparison, and produces a watermarked batch ZIP alongside a video — either a Ken Burns slideshow or an AI-generated drone-camera-movement effect — ready for Reels, Stories, or YouTube. The vendor states no manual adjustment is required at any step, though a one-click generative editor and step-by-step undo are available per photo.

The differentiating feature is the drone-effect video generation from still images. Rather than filming footage, the platform generates real camera-movement simulation from existing photos — a capability that lets a solo agent produce content that previously required a drone operator and video editor. Narration can be added optionally. This collapses a multi-day production pipeline into 60 seconds for a listing that already has photos.

BrokerLens.ai fits agencies processing high volumes of phone-shot listings who need visual consistency across dozens of agents without a design team. The virtual furniture feature is in BETA and covers four preset Brazilian-market styles; teams needing custom staging or client-specific aesthetic direction will find the preset model limiting. The platform has no API access and no self-hosted option, which means any agency wanting to trigger processing from their own CRM or property management system cannot automate the upload step — it stays a manual portal workflow. Teams that hit that integration ceiling typically move processing into a general-purpose image API like Adobe Firefly or a custom pipeline, losing the room-classification and video features in exchange for programmability.
